Geochemical Characteristics And Sedimentary Source Analysis Of Black Shale Series Of Lower Cambrian Of The HuiLi-HuiZe-Dongchuan

Early Cambrian black shales, which are located in southern China, are the mainly strata bearing many large and super large metallic and nonmetallic deposits.Theformation of this shale is associated with global hypoxia events and have beenregarded as important reproducible sedimentary facies, representing an environmental upheaval.Lower Cambrian black rock series widely developed well in Huili, Huidong, Huize and Dongchuan area of southwestern margin of the Yangtze block.Therefore, itis of great theoretical and practical significance to study the formation of this lower Cambrian black shale, which is regarded as the indicator of mineralization and environment.This paper focuses on the sedimentary environment, material source and tectonic setting of source region of lower Cambrian black rock series, the characteristics of main and trace elements and rare earth elements are studied by the means of systematic sample of Yuhucun, Qiongzhusi and Canglangpu black rock series,according to sedimentology and geochemistry. Comprehensive analysis of regional ancient geography background and profile sedimentary characteristics indicate that marine transgression and sea-level rise occured during Early Cambrian, causing hypoxia event. The environment of that time is ittoral-neritic sea to bathyal region.To the early Late Cambrian, marine regression event happened, the sea level began to fall and water power have strengthened, indicating that the characteristics of environment was similar with foreshore and backshore. The n(V)/n(V+Ni), n(Ni)/n(Co), n(U)/n(Th) andĪ“U features suggest that this area was under the anoxic reducing environment at that time and also the transition environment between hot water and normal deposition. The NASC Normalized REE patterns show that the total amount of rare earth elements is higher. An obvious differentiation between light and heavy REE is observed and Eu showed a negative anomaly, indicating that the sediments of this area are from the upper crust and mixed by a certain amount of hot water sediments. Study on combination and ratio characteristics of the main and trace elements and REEs indicate that the sediments are mainly terrigenous materials, supplemented by exhalative sedimentation and affected by a large number of biological sedimentation.The natures of source rocks are similar with andesite, dacite and sedimentary rocks.The tectonic setting of source is mainly continental arc and active continental margin with mixed sources.On the basis of above research, with combination of U-Pb dating analysis, the source of this black shales is from Kangdian old land located on the southwestern of the study area.
